Greek · Adjectives
akrivós
Expensive
Costing a lot of money.
Αυτό το ξενοδοχείο είναι πολύ ακριβό.
This hotel is very expensive.
'Ακριβός' (akrivós) comes from the ancient Greek 'ἀκριβής', meaning 'exact' or 'precise'. The term has grown to denote value in a financial sense.
'Ακριβός' is applied in both spoken and written contexts, formal and informal, particularly in discussions about price and quality.
